Given Input numbers are 120, 306, 943, 640
To find the GCD of numbers using factoring list out all the divisors of each number
Divisors of 120
List of positive integer divisors of 120 that divides 120 without a remainder.
1, 2, 3, 4, 5, 6, 8, 10, 12, 15, 20, 24, 30, 40, 60, 120
Divisors of 306
List of positive integer divisors of 306 that divides 306 without a remainder.
1, 2, 3, 6, 9, 17, 18, 34, 51, 102, 153, 306
Divisors of 943
List of positive integer divisors of 943 that divides 943 without a remainder.
1, 23, 41, 943
Divisors of 640
List of positive integer divisors of 640 that divides 640 without a remainder.
1, 2, 4, 5, 8, 10, 16, 20, 32, 40, 64, 80, 128, 160, 320, 640
Greatest Common Divisior
We found the divisors of 120, 306, 943, 640 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 120, 306, 943, 640 is 1.
Therefore, GCD of numbers 120, 306, 943, 640 is 1
Given Input Data is 120, 306, 943, 640
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 120 is 2 x 2 x 2 x 3 x 5
Prime Factorization of 306 is 2 x 3 x 3 x 17
Prime Factorization of 943 is 23 x 41
Prime Factorization of 640 is 2 x 2 x 2 x 2 x 2 x 2 x 2 x 5
The above numbers do not have any common prime factor. So GCD is 1
